Spot: Slow cooking porridge; Futures: Stir-frying on high heat

Spot is slow cooking, choosing the right cryptocurrency is like picking good ingredients, investing steadily while stocking up, adding more fuel during a bear market, and keeping the lid on tight during a bull market. The core principle is to hold on, regardless of the fluctuating flames, until it reaches the right flavor.

Futures are stir-frying, with urgent heat and rapid action, making it easy for beginners to burn the pot. Even experienced traders should use less ingredients (small position), closely monitor the timing (take profit and stop loss), and turn off the heat at the first sign of smoke, rather than waiting for the pot to explode before running away.

Don't use the pot for stewing meat to stir-fry; consider spot as the main dish, while futures are at most a sprinkle of chili powder for flavor. Mixing up the primary and secondary can easily lead to a kitchen disaster.

Keep them separate: treat spot as ballast and futures as pocket money for speculation; distinguishing the primary from the secondary helps avoid accidents.
